I believe it will be around that time frame as well, but I can also see MSU not being in a big hurry to replace the East side. After all, they don't currently gain much from improving the East side other than a better looking stadium, seats are seats. However, if they want to add sky boxes and fill in some of the gaps in the stadium at the same time, they can gain more revenue. I'm curious if they will just go the donated money route or look for a big stadium sponsor or go for the combination donation/loan financing like they did for the South end zone.
